**Q: Why does RestockRight sometimes schedule a visit to a machine that still shows adequate stock?**

A: The planner optimizes routes, not individual machines. If a technician is already passing a machine on the Fenwick Park loop, RestockRight may add a top-up stop when marginal cost is near zero, even above the restock threshold. Reviewers should note this logic lives in `route_consolidation.py`, not the threshold module — a common source of confusion in past reviews. If the behavior still looks wrong for a specific route, raise it here.

escalation mailbox, bafog-fafog: ulador@paliqlabs.internal

Scrubber service (Pixwash) strips EXIF from all user uploads before storage. Runs as a sidecar on the ingest pods. GPS and serial fields are dropped; orientation is preserved and re-applied. Do not bypass for thumbnails — they leak metadata too. Failures go to the quarantine bucket for manual review. Config lives in the ingest repo. Full maintainer notes, edge cases, and the rotation schedule are kept at:

dashboard of kafof-tahaf = https://confluence.tolvaqsys.internal/projects/browse/display/a1250987

**Checklist item 7 — Log compaction on Pipewren queues**

Future maintainers: before shipping, make sure compaction actually ran on the `orders-events` topic and didn't just pretend to (it's done that twice). Check segment counts dropped and consumers caught up cleanly. If anything looks off, ping whoever owns Pipewren that week. Record the verification run against the trace token below.

session token of tajog-fahaf = htk21_4ae55819f45410afcb307

The garage occupancy feed for the Brindlewood campus arrives over a message queue every thirty seconds, one record per level, published by the Stallgrid edge boxes. Counts can briefly go negative when a sensor double-fires on exit; the ingest job clamps these to zero and flags the interval. If the feed stalls for more than five minutes, the dashboard falls back to the last known snapshot. Sensor mappings, queue names, and the replay procedure are documented on the internal page below.

runbook for tahog-kadug: https://gitlab.qirvanworks.corp/projects/pages/view/b139298aed28